1. Password Manager
Keeping track of multiple passwords can be a hassle. A password manager like LastPass or Dashlane can securely store all your passwords and automatically fill them in for you.
2. File Converter
Have you ever received a file in a format that your device doesn’t support? With an online file converter like Zamzar or Convertio, you can easily convert files to different formats without the need for any software installation.
3. Grammar Checker
Whether you’re writing an important email or a blog post, a grammar checker like Grammarly can help you avoid embarrassing mistakes. It can detect grammar, spelling, and punctuation errors, ensuring that your writing is polished and professional.
4. Image Editor
Need to crop, resize, or add filters to your photos? An online image editor like Pixlr or Canva provides a user-friendly interface with a wide range of editing tools to enhance your images.
5. Cloud Storage
Gone are the days of carrying around USB drives. With cloud storage services like Google Drive or Dropbox, you can securely store and access your files from anywhere, on any device.
6. Calendar App
Stay organized and never miss an important event with a free online calendar app like Google Calendar or Microsoft Outlook. You can schedule appointments, set reminders, and even share your calendar with others.
7. Video Conferencing
With the rise of remote work, video conferencing has become essential. Tools like Zoom or Google Meet allow you to connect with colleagues, friends, and family through high-quality video calls.
8. Language Translator
Break down language barriers with an online language translator like Google Translate or DeepL. These tools can instantly translate text or even entire web pages into different languages.
9. PDF Reader
View, annotate, and sign PDF documents without the need for dedicated software. Online PDF readers like Adobe Acrobat Online or Smallpdf provide all the essential features you need.
10. Project Management
Whether you’re working on a personal project or collaborating with a team, a project management tool like Trello or Asana can help you stay organized and keep track of tasks.
